The Keithley 2100/100 is a 6½-digit USB multimeter delivering precision DC and AC measurements across voltage, current, resistance, frequency, and temperature. With 0.0038% basic DC voltage accuracy on the 10V range and 0.013% resistance accuracy on the 10kΩ range, this instrument serves R&D engineers, test engineers, scientists, and students in benchtop and automated test environments.
## Technical Specifications
**Measurement Functions**
• DC and AC voltage (True RMS) to 750V
• DC and AC current (True RMS) to 3.000000A
• Resistance from 100Ω to 100MΩ
• Frequency measurement 3 Hz to 300 kHz
• RTD temperature with ±0.1°C accuracy (-100°C to +100°C) and ±0.2°C (-200°C to +630°C)
**Performance**
• 50 triggered readings/second at 6½ digits via USB
• Over 2000 readings/second at 4½ digits into internal buffer
• Input protection: 1000V (2-wire mode)
• Input bias current: <30pA at 25°C
**Temperature Measurement**
Supports PT100, D100, F100, PT385, and PT3916 RTDs with 0.001°C resolution across two ranges. Maximum lead resistance: 12Ω per lead at 1mA pulsed sensor current.
**Mathematical Functions**
RATIO, percentage, Min/Max, NULL, limits, mX+b, dB, and dBm calculations.
## Key Features
• TMC-compliant USB 2.0 interface with Agilent 34401A command emulation for plug-and-play integration
• 5×7 dot matrix VFD display with three-color annunciators and selectable front/rear inputs
• Rugged construction with removable rubber bumpers for bench, portable, or stacking applications
• Sturdy carrying handle for field use
• 1 PLC or continuous trigger measurement modes
## Software Integration
Included KI-Tool application enables real-time charting and graphing of measurements without programming.
